DALLAS and BOULDER, Colo., Jun 30, 2003 /PRNewswire-FirstCall via COMTEX/
-- Dean Foods Company (NYSE: DF) and Horizon Organic Holding Corporation
(Nasdaq: HCOW) announced today the signing of a definitive agreement by
which Dean Foods will acquire the 87% equity interest in Horizon Organic
it does not currently own. Dean Foods will purchase the remaining 87%
interest in Horizon Organic for a cash price of approximately $216
million, or $24 per share and will assume approximately $40 million in
debt. The transaction, which was approved by the board of directors of
both companies, is expected to close during the fourth quarter of 2003.
The transaction is subject to approval by Horizon Organic's shareholders
and expiration of the waiting period under the Hart-Scott Rodino Antitrust
Improvements Act.
Horizon Organic markets the leading brand of certified organic foods in
the United States and the leading brand of certified organic milk in both
the United States and the United Kingdom. In 2002, Horizon Organic
reported revenues of approximately $187 million, and in April 2003, the
company announced that it had reached a milestone of $200 million in
annual sales. Horizon Organic's product line in the United States includes
organic milk, a full line of organic dairy products and organic juices,
pudding, fruit jels and eggs. In the U.K., the company markets and sells
organic milk, yogurt and butter under the Rachel's Organic brand.
